Webb22 juli 2024 · Total Productivity = Total Output / Total Input. Let’s walk through an example. If a manufacturing facility is able to produce $12,000 worth of product using inputs such as machinery, and labor costs that equal $6,000, the productivity output would equal two. Total Productivity = Total Output / Total Input = $12,000 / $6,000 = 2.0.
